Latest Patents

Among his latest patents, Avitabile has developed a method that involves receiving images from both a dynamic vision sensor and a traditional image sensor. This method identifies areas of movement within the overlapping fields of view captured by both sensors. It applies a higher level of image compression to areas without movement, optimizing the processing of images sent to a neural network.
